In 2015, Amir Taaki, an Iranian-British coder notorious in the politically-loaded cryptography software and bitcoin, found himself holding an AK-47 in Syria fighting ISIS alongside Kurdish rebels. Taaki had for years preached a crypto-anarchist revolution online. But then he found there was a very real revolution occurring in Syria.
